Understanding Ounces and Teaspoons
An ounce is a unit of weight, and in the context of powders, it refers to a specific mass. A teaspoon, on the other hand, is a unit of volume, equivalent to about 5 milliliters. The conversion between ounces and teaspoons is complicated by the fact that different powders have different densities. Density is defined as mass per unit volume, meaning that a given volume of one powder can weigh significantly more or less than the same volume of another powder, depending on their respective densities.
Density and Its Impact on Conversion
To accurately convert a powdered ounce to teaspoons, one must know the density of the powder. For example, if we are dealing with salt, which has a relatively high density compared to powdered sugar, the number of teaspoons in an ounce will be significantly less for salt than for sugar due to salt’s higher density. Table salt, for instance, has a density of about 2.17 grams per cubic centimeter (g/cm³), while powdered sugar might have a density around 0.7 g/cm³, depending on how finely it is powdered and how it is packed.
Calculating Teaspoons from Ounces
To calculate how many teaspoons are in a powdered ounce, we need to follow a series of steps:
– First, we need the density of the powder in question. This can often be found on the packaging or through online research.
– Next, we convert the density from grams per cubic centimeter to grams per milliliter since 1 cubic centimeter equals 1 milliliter.
– Knowing that a teaspoon is approximately equal to 5 milliliters, we can calculate the weight of one teaspoon of the powder by multiplying the density in g/mL by 5 mL.
– Finally, we divide the weight of one ounce (approximately 28.35 grams) by the weight of one teaspoon of the powder to find out how many teaspoons are in an ounce.

Challenges in Conversion
One of the main challenges in converting powdered ounces to teaspoons is the variability in powder density. This variability can stem from several factors, including the method of powder production, the presence of air pockets within the powder, and how the powder is packed. Moreover, the density of a powder can change over time due to factors like humidity and settling, which can further complicate accurate conversions.
